Sexual assault of any type is a serious offense The prosecutor and district attorney or equivalent will determine with what degree of assault the defendant will be charged. While many people understand the basic concepts of what constitutes sexual assault, the law differentiates between various degrees of the crime in order to more effectively prosecute offenders

In total, there are four degrees of sexual assault in california Sexual assault may be charged as first, second, third, or fourth degree sexual assault, with first degree being the most serious and fourth degree being the least serious First degree sexual assault is the most severe type of offense, while fourth degree is.

In the united states, criminal classifications are separated regarding sexual assault crimes across each state, which typically go from first degree to fourth degree sexual assault

These degrees represent variations in the circumstances surrounding the crime. When an allegation of sexual assault without penetration does not meet the requirements of criminal sexual conduct in the second degree, a person will be charged with csc in the 4th degree.

Do you know someone who is being investigated for sexual assault Being convicted of 1st, 2nd, 3rd or 4th degree criminal sexual assault has serious penalties Distinguishing 4th degree from other sexual assault charges compared to its tougher counterparts, 4th degree sexual assault is seen as less severe In wisconsin, for instance, it falls under a class a misdemeanor.

(b) sexual assault in the fourth degree is a class a misdemeanor or, if the victim of the offense is under sixteen years of age, a class d felony.
